The postcode NG17 9GZ is located in Ashfield, in the county of Nottinghamshire. It was introduced in April 1986 and terminated in December 1994.NG17 9GZ is a large user postcode, usually allocated to a single address receiving at least 500 mail items per day.
NG17 9GZ is one of the less de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 5.8 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of NG17 9GZ as Rural residents > Ageing rural dwellers > Rural employment and retirees.
